As part of our continued support to a major automotive client, we are seeking a Powertrain Transmission Engineer to support the design, development, and delivery of high-performance combustion engine components and subsystems across vehicle programmes. Reporting to the Senior Powertrain Engineer, the role focuses on identifying, analysing, and resolving powertrain component issues encountered in service while contributing to the development and integration of robust engineering solutions.
Working within a multidisciplinary team of powertrain engineers and technical experts, the successful candidate will take ownership of component and subsystem design from concept through to delivery, ensuring alignment with programme targets for cost, quality, and timing. The role also involves close collaboration with vehicle integration teams, suppliers, and development partners to ensure seamless integration of engine systems within the wider vehicle architecture.
This position offers the opportunity to influence the application of existing and emerging technologies within high-performance vehicle programmes while supporting the delivery of innovative powertrain solutions.
Responsibilities- Transmission Design & Development
Design and develop transmission and driveline components and subsystems from concept through to production release.
Support the resolution of transmission-related failures identified during development or in-service operation.
Contribute to the development and integration of transmission systems within vehicle powertrain architectures.
- Engineering Investigation & Problem Resolution
Apply structured engineering methodologies to diagnose issues and deliver effective solutions.
Utilise problem-solving tools such as 8D, Root Cause Analysis (RCA), Fishbone/Ishikawa, and IS/IS NOT analysis.
Manage Quality Concern Reports (QCRs) and Quality Notifications (QNs).
- Design Integration & Delivery
Ensure transmission components integrate seamlessly with engine, chassis, and vehicle systems.
Coordinate Design for Manufacture, Assembly, and Service reviews.
Deliver components and subsystems in line with the Engineering Timing Release Schedule (ETRS).
- Documentation & Programme Support
Maintain technical documentation including DFMEA, DVP, and technical specifications.
Manage component Bills of Materials (BoM) within SAP.
Support design release activities in accordance with the organisation’s Automotive Development Process.
- Supplier & Stakeholder Collaboration
Work with suppliers and technical partners to deliver transmission components to specification.
Support programme reporting and provide technical input to project reviews.
